## Evidence-led work plan

### 1. Before customer one: write the smallest credible market

Choose one role, one company condition and one expensive or urgent job.

### 2. Customers one to three: sell learning with a paid boundary

Ask for a commercial commitment around a narrow outcome instead of offering an endless free beta.

### 4. Customers seven to ten: repeat one acquisition path

Use the strongest source of qualified conversations again before adding another channel.

### 5. The weekly scoreboard for the first ten

Count qualified conversations, confirmed problems, paid experiments, activated accounts and retained customers by source.
